Package: util-linux
Version: 2.13.1.1-1
Severity: normal

joey@gnu:~>SHELL=bash script
Script started, file is typescript
bash: No such file or directory
Script done, file is typescript

script uses execl to run the shell, just changing it to use execlp
should fix this.

While SHELL typically contains the full path to the shell, for reasons I
don't quite understand, screen resets it to the unqualified shell
command. I first ran into this problem when attempting to run script
inside a screen session.
